## Support

So you've inherited Moonpull, our little tide-table widget. Good news: it's mostly self-sufficient. It pulls predictions from the Harborfell data service nightly and caches them for seven days, so brief outages won't hurt anyone. Bad news: the chart renderer is fragile around daylight-saving boundaries — see the KNOWN_ISSUES file before touching it. Bug reports from harbor partners arrive via the shared tracker. If you're stuck, or the Harborfell feed changes shape again, write to the address below.

billing contact of yawip-yadup = druath.casdor@nelvrolabs.internal

**Ticket: Expired credential blocks SQL lint plugin registry**

External plugin authors for the Slatequery linter have reported that publishing rule packs fails with a 401. Root cause: the shared publishing credential for the internal Slatequery registry expired on schedule and the renewal automation was never pointed at the new vault path. A replacement credential has been issued; plugin authors should update their publish config to use the key below.

gateway credential: kto23_LX9A4ys6i4nzHtpOLNLodKK

## Approvals: Laundry-Locker Access

Access to the Spinwell laundry-locker system requires a badge grant plus manager approval in PortalHub. Submit the request under Facilities > Lockers. Grants expire quarterly; renewals need no new approval. Emergency overrides go through the Facilities duty channel. All final approvals route to one person.

approver of yawig-yajef = Briius Jorix

## Authentication

The Proselint-X documentation linter checks every docs PR against the Harborwick style service. It needs a service credential to fetch the shared rule set; without one it falls back to a stale local copy and results will differ from CI. Export the credential before running the linter locally. Use the following key for the style service.

gateway credential: kto3_qfe